This PR updates the Hollowbay restock planner for the Cartwheel vending fleet. It replaces the fixed weekly restock cadence with a demand-weighted schedule: machines with faster sell-through get visited sooner, slow movers get deferred up to the max interval. The planner now also respects van capacity when batching routes, so a single run can't over-assign a driver. Tests cover the scheduling math and the capacity clamp; the route optimizer itself is untouched. All thresholds the new scheduler uses are defined in one place, shown here.

limits module of fahaf-kagug:
WEIGHTS = {
    "zorok": 591,
    "fendor": 661,
    "belix": 110,
}

Minutes — Management Meeting, Hollenbeck House

Present: Ms Arden, Mr Quill, Ms Fetterly. The committee reviewed the proposed 8% price increase for legacy Corvane subscribers, effective next quarter. Retention modelling suggests churn below 3%. Communications will be staged over six weeks. The increase is timed deliberately, for the reason recorded below for the board's eyes only.

management briefing: The southern region missed its Wenvan quota by 3.5 percent last quarter. Ralysek Holdings plans to lower the Fraox list price by 41.2 percent in November. The pricing group signed off on a budget of $176.6 million for Project Tamael. The renewal with Wenvanix Systems closes at $320.5 million a year, 62.6 percent below the last contract.

Going forward, all plugins must acquire connections through the Octavel pool broker, which enforces per-plugin ceilings, idle reaping, and acquisition timeouts. Plugins that exceed their ceiling will receive a fast failure rather than queuing indefinitely, so authors should implement retry with jitter. The broker's enforced defaults, which plugin manifests may lower but never raise, are listed below.

tuning table, fawip-fahag:
WEIGHTS = {
    "novwyn": 452,
    "casdor": 675,
}